48 Hours in Queenstown

Updated: Apr 26

Queenstown is a popular destination town all year round, but it’s particularly spectacular during winter - and skiing isn’t the only thing it’s famous for.


Day One - head out for a walk to the lakefront, it’s like glass first thing in the morning. Grab a coffee and get yourself to Skyline Queenstown for a gondola and luge ride. After lunch, jump on a helicopter tour, with an alpine landing on The Remarkables. Finish with a drive out to the iconic Cardrona Hotel and onto Lake Wanaka.


Day Two - start at Onsen Hot Pools. These boutique outdoor pools are just outside of Queenstown and have the most incredible views overlooking the Shotover River Canyon. Relax in style before lunch and a walk in Arrowtown. After lunch, nip back to Arthurs Point for your turn on the Shotover Jet. Wrap up with a round of golf or a spa treatment at Millbrook Resort.
